Add 9/40 and 63/7
1st number: 9/40, 2nd number: 9 0/7
9/40 + 63/7 is 369/40.
Steps for adding fractions
- Find the least common denominator or LCM of the two denominators:
LCM of 40 and 7 is 280
Next, find the equivalent fraction of both fractional numbers with denominator 280 - For the 1st fraction, since 40 × 7 = 280,
9/40 = 9 × 7/40 × 7 = 63/280 - Likewise, for the 2nd fraction, since 7 × 40 = 280,
63/7 = 63 × 40/7 × 40 = 2520/280 - Add the two like fractions:
63/280 + 2520/280 = 63 + 2520/280 = 2583/280 - 2583/280 simplified gives 369/40
- So, 9/40 + 63/7 = 369/40
